Wasn't there something about not using a granny with a 40/42t in case it effed the freehub?

EDIT - [url= http://int.oneupcomponents.com/pages/compatibility ]Here[/url] on the One Up site under Can I use the OneUp Adapter Sprocket on a 2X10 setup?

'We don’t recommend using anything smalller than a 26T granny. With the extra torque you’re making we wouldn't want you to damage your freehub pawls.'
